I am trying to decide to have surgery at home in states for 14K vs mexico with Dr. Aceves for 8750K. Plus airfare with my companion etc will probably bring totally to close to 10k. My family wants me to stay in the states. My local doc is good but has less experience with sleeves than Dr Aceves and I would only get 1 night in the hospital vs 3 with Aceves. I am freaking out trying to make this decision. HELP- Sleeve Md's In Kentucky

I am EXACTLY where you are now, deciding between the two and have done so much research between the two. I think either is a good decision. I asked the same question about the drain. All surgeons do not use the drain. It is a preference and their past experience. It would definately be more comfortable without I would think. Both use top grade materials, have full hospital facilities, great reputations, staff, etc. I don't know which to chose either. I am looking at dates, airfare, drive time to the facilities, etc.- How Many Times Did You...
